## Onboarding — Markdown Pipeline (Inkmere)

Inkmere docs render through a three-stage pipeline: parse, sanitize, emit. Releases rebuild all templates; never hot-patch emitted HTML. Broken renders usually mean a sanitizer rule change — check the rules diff first. The render cluster only accepts builds from the release channel, and every build artifact must be signed before upload. Sign artifacts with the deploy key below.

release key, hafop-tajef: bky13_s2vaFVNJTHfBL

## Deployment Notes — Glimmercache

Heads up: Glimmercache (the thumbnail service behind Pondwright's gallery pages) has a known memory leak in the image cache layer. Evicted entries keep a reference to their decoded bitmap, so the heap creeps up roughly 40 MB an hour under normal load. Until the fix from the Tidefall sprint lands, we just restart the pods nightly via the cron job — not elegant, but it works. If you're deploying a new build, keep the restart schedule in place. Deploy with the following settings.

settings of fafog-haduf:
ZORIX_PIN=4648
ZORIX_METRICS_HOST=metrics.zorix.paliqsys.corp
ZORIX_LOG_LEVEL=info
ZORIX_TENANT=druix

Memo — quarterly stock-count ledger. The Q3 stock-count ledger for the Birchlow warehouse is complete and bound, ready for transfer to head office at Stanmere on Friday's run. It is the only signed copy, so it travels in the document wallet, logged out at departure. Please follow the courier hand-over instruction given below.

dispatch memo: the lamwyn fenwyn courier leaves the wenir ledger at gate 7175 under passcode 822969